 Being slightly out a touch with up to date affairs ( my choice )    Is axel  the front man with a "new " band behind him ?

  I am guessing by the other threads its not a full line up/reunion ?
Title: Re: GnR
Post by: Sider on November 24, 2008, 21:22:11
Being slightly out a touch with up to date affairs ( my choice )    Is axel  the front man with a "new " band behind him ?

  I am guessing by the other threads its not a full line up/reunion ?

Nah, when the band dissolved, Axl kept the rights to the name. Instead of being a band of equal parnerts, now it is a franchise owned by Axl Rose, with minions who do his will. I´ve had a listen to the record, and from my point of view, it is not worth it.
